About IFIMAC

The IFIMAC - Condensed Matter Physics Center is a new María de Maeztu Excellence Research Unit located in the campus of the Universidad Autónoma de Madrid pursuing cutting-edge research and scientific excellence. It comprises researchers from several university departments aiming to advance the limits of knowledge in both theoretical and experimental Condensed Matter Physics. Sixty four researchers constitute its permanent staff with up to ninety postdoctoral researchers and Ph.D students.

International Year of Quantum Science and Technology

On 7 June 2024, the United Nations proclaimed 2025 as the International Year of Quantum Science and Technology, https://quantum2025.org/en/. IFIMAC is a major stakeholder in quantum science, having made pioneering developments in quantum photonics, quantum materials and computation. Furthermore, IFIMAC actively participates in the organization of the International Conference of Low Temperature Physics, www.lt30.es, a meeting of the International Union of Pure and Applied Physics, held only every three years, which is the main discussion center around quantum technologies from the perspective of solid state devices and quantum condensates.
